I am not on a "diet" exactly, but I am trying out this iphone/pod app, called Lose It!, that gives me a custom budget of calories based on how many pounds I want to lose per week. What I liked about it was that it had a lot of name brand foods already plugged in and you can put in new foods that you eat. There are also options by how much you should eat to maintain the same weight and so on... My favorite was that I don't really need to exercise all the time doing this and I could need a different amount of calories each day. Most importantly, this app was free!
